Abstract
In this paper, we present a variable-length 256-point to 2048-point FFT processor for 4x4 Multiple Input Multiple Output(MIMO)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plex- ing(OFDM) systems. In general, the amount the FFT processors for MIMO system are dependent on the maximum required of data sequences and the basic unit butterfly has the 1/r idle time where r is radix-r. It is area-ineffective for VLSI implement. By the proposed butterfly sharing technique, the effective hardware utilization can be improved to 100%. The radix-42 algorithm is sufficient to deal with the four data sequences simul- taneous and reduce the hardware complexity and cost. The signal quantization noise ratio(SQNR) is over 43 dB for QPSK and 16/64-QAM signals. Moreover we imple- ment the variable length FFT processor in UMC 90um technology. The core area is 3.193248mm2 with 83.3MHz.
